BERI-BERI.
The deaths from this disease were 1,502 or a percentage of 9.65 of the total deaths.
This is an absolute increase of 232 deaths over those for 1923 namely 1,270.
There is also an increase of 1.48 in the figures showing the percentage of deaths from Beri-beri, of total deaths registered during 1923 and 1924.
The following table shows the deaths from Beri-beri for the ten years 1915 to 1924 inclusive,

The total of deaths registered as due to this disease during 1924 was 52, this being the smallest figure for deaths ascribed to this disease for the last seven years.
